With Halloween quickly approaching, we are enjoying doing a range of themed crafts. We usually carve a number of pumpkins each year, this year we decided to include some new additions to our collection…some bumpkins! These make a great present, and are incredibly fun, easy and quick to make.
Here is what you’ll need;
- Orange child friendly paint,
- White card,
- Wet wipes,
- Sharpie pens.
Here is how to make them;
- Paint the lower part of their buttocks (if you paint too high, the print won’t be a fully formed pumpkin shape).
- Sit them onto a piece of white card.
- Allow the print to dry.
- Decorate with the desired design.
